CHICAGO (April 8, 2015) — The U.S. Soccer Coaching Department will conduct National Coaching Schools for “A” License Renewal Courses from  July 13-17 in Carson, California, and  from Sept. 17-21 in Chicago, Illinois. The July renewal course will center around U.S. Soccer’s Development Academy Finals, while the September course will feature an in-depth look at the Chicago Fire as they prepare for a match against Orlando City SC.

Registration for these course options will begin on Monday, April 13. Interested applicants should review the FAQ’s (listed below) and confirm their eligibility prior to attempting to register.

Participants at U.S. Soccer’s National Coaching Schools will have the opportunity to earn a nationally recognized license from U.S. Soccer, a member of Fédération Internationale de Football Association (FIFA), and the governing body of soccer in all its forms in the United States.

In a typical course, coaches will interact with the nation’s top-level instructors, including current and former national team coaches, professional and international coaches. The licensing programs are focused on teaching current theoretical and practical knowledge to provide coaches with the ability to improve the everyday training environment for elite players.
